Transaction 1b277952289856359b066fab11036e01079d76104262d4c47826bb1b1fefa888
1 Input
1 Output
-
1b277952289856359b066fab11036e01079d76104262d4c47826bb1b1fefa888:0
- value
- 66885
- script pubkey
- OP_0 OP_PUSHBYTES_20 ba2e0a1ab3186bc8f56736e0bea2c599a08415ab
- address
- bc1qhghq5x4nrp4u3at8xmstagk9nxsgg9dt5plzcy